Internal Memo — Receiving Site, Thornegate Annex. Following yesterday's missed pick-up by Redmoor Transit, all outbound and inbound runs are reassigned to Pellam Line Couriers effective immediately. Expect their van at the east bay, mornings only. Manifests and seals remain unchanged; log arrivals as usual. When the Pellam driver presents for the first hand-over, pass on the following:

dispatch memo: the lamwyn fenwyn courier leaves the wenir ledger at gate 7175 under passcode 822969

Parcelflow webhook onboarding. The Driftgate relay posts parcel scan events to our internal Trackline service over mTLS. Payloads are signed with HMAC-SHA256; verify the signature header before processing. Retries follow exponential backoff, capped at six attempts. No PII beyond parcel reference codes is transmitted. Scope of the credential below is read-and-acknowledge only, limited to the staging relay. Use the following key when registering the webhook endpoint with Trackline.

app token of bawep-hafog = kto7_vwrmnlx

# Break-Glass: Catalog Cache Invalidation

Scope: the Pinrow product catalog at Veldstone Retail. If stale prices persist after a purge and the Hollowmere invalidation queue is wedged, use break-glass to flush the edge tier directly. Contractors: get verbal sign-off from the catalog lead first. Steps: open the Hollowmere admin shell, select emergency-flush, confirm the tenant, and run it once — repeated flushes thrash the origin. Access is logged and expires after 20 minutes. Unseal the admin shell with the passphrase below.

recovery phrase for kahop-tajog: istix-casvan